Temperature level Considerations
When it pertains to industrial external painting, temperature level plays a crucial duty in the outcome of your job. If you're repainting in extreme warm, the paint can dry out also swiftly, resulting in concerns like poor attachment and unequal finishes. You want to go for temperatures in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the best outcomes. Below 50 ° F, paint might not cure effectively, while above 85 ° F, you risk blistering and splitting.
Timing your job with the appropriate temperatures is important. Start your work early in the morning or later on in the afternoon when it's cooler, especially during warm months.

Moisture Degrees
Humidity degrees significantly affect the success of your business outside paint project. When the humidity is too high, it can prevent paint drying out and healing, causing a series of concerns like bad adhesion and finish high quality.
If you're preparing a task throughout wet problems, you could locate that the paint takes longer to completely dry, which can extend your job timeline and increase expenses.
Conversely, low moisture can likewise position difficulties. Paint might dry out also promptly, protecting against proper application and leading to an unequal surface.
You'll intend to check the humidity levels carefully to guarantee you're functioning within the optimal variety, typically in between 40% and 70%.
To get the very best results, take into consideration making use of a hygrometer to gauge moisture prior to beginning your task.
If you discover the degrees are outside the optimal variety, you may need to adjust your routine or select paints developed for variable problems.
Constantly seek advice from the supplier's guidelines for details recommendations on humidity tolerance.
